logo

Output 1b537e17630bc3350561c8b589b86cea07709433bf4a0f9af8e4e2b12a8a00ca:2

value
2708871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cae39a5d42e97092a570a5645b21f5ac87282b6 OP_EQUAL
address
37DsBRziFN6GHDuwxVVP2i2uu1sTXKDZza
transaction
1b537e17630bc3350561c8b589b86cea07709433bf4a0f9af8e4e2b12a8a00ca